Tipster Digital Chat Station took to Weibo, the Chinese microblogging platform, to claim that the rumored OnePlus 10T or OnePlus 10 will launch in the second half of 2022 with a triple rear camera setup. Although the tipster did not name the smartphone, the Weibo post had attached a render of the smartphone which was leaked last week and claimed to be the OnePlus 10 or OnePlus 10T. According to the tipster, the main OnePlus 10 or OnePlus 10T camera would be a 50-megapixel 1/1.5-inch shooter, along with an 8-megapixel sensor and a 2-megapixel shooter. On the front, the smartphone is said to have a 16-megapixel selfie camera. The previous render leak had indicated that OnePlus would ignore its iconic alert slider for the smartphone this time around, which the tipster agreed with.
As a reminder, renders of the smartphone showed the rumored handset in black color with a triple rear camera setup. Tipster Digital Chat Station, while talking about these leaked renders, pointed out that while the layout of the front and rear cameras in the renders were correct, the aspect ratio of the camera module was not. The color matching was also wrong, as well as the built-in volume keys. Tipster also added that the availability of the smartphone’s Hasselblad is still questionable with the material of the middle frame.
Previously, there was a lot of confusion regarding the moniker of OnePlus’ next smartphone. The codename Project Ovaltine has been claimed by one tipster to be the OnePlus 10 and by another tipster to be the flagship smartphone, OnePlus 10T.
Some key specs of the OnePlus 10 series smartphone being developed under the codename Project Ovaltine are known. The smartphone is said to feature a 6.7-inch Full HD+ AMOLED touchscreen display with a 120Hz refresh rate. The handset is expected to come with a Snapdragon 8+ Gen 1 SoC and a 4,800mAh battery. It is also said to work on OxygenOS 12.
